Output 0815418061e29f9babfdd4ed60103733eade4e291d878a748ff557a545efea4d:6

value
46787
script pubkey
OP_0 OP_PUSHBYTES_20 bedc586b9c3d7ec3b5ecda0df3d0e2eabbb34ec1
address
bc1qhmw9s6uu84lv8d0vmgxl858za2amxnkpcshysa
transaction
0815418061e29f9babfdd4ed60103733eade4e291d878a748ff557a545efea4d
confirmations
27117
spent
true